Program Description

The Associate of Arts, AA at JCCC is a general transfer degree and partners well with the first two years of most bachelor degree programs. Students pursuing the AA may select courses that satisfy both the AA degree requirements and lower division requirements for a bachelor’s degree at four-year institutions. The elective hours within the AA allow students to complete additional general education and lower division courses required for specific majors. The AA degree requires completion of 60 credit hours. Meeting with a JCCC counselor is strongly recommended for selection of appropriate courses. 

The School of Professional and Graduate Studies offer curricula leading to a degree of Bachelor of Business Administration. This program is an undergraduate sequence of courses designed for working professionals. The core sequence provides students with knowledge and skills in management, leadership, finance, accounting, marketing, technology, economics, and project planning. In addition to the foundational and core coursework, students select a major in one of the following areas: Organizational Management, Project Management, Sport Management, Human Resources or Marketing. Through this sequence of courses, students develop critical thinking, problem solving, and written and oral communications skills, as well as leadership and teamwork skills. In support of the University’s mission, the program encourages the development of responsible, ethical, and socially committed graduates.

Admission Requirements

The Bachelor of Business Administration degree requires the completion of 120 credit hours. 

  1. Official transcripts for all college work completed.
  2. An on-line application.

Students must meet the following requirements to earn a Bachelor of Business Administration degree:

  • Successful completion of at least 120 credit hours (Residency requirements: A minimum of 30 hours of upper-level course work [numbered 300 or higher] must be taken at Baker University.)
  • Cumulative GPA of at least 2.0
  • Successful completion of a major area of concentration with a GPA of at least 2.0.
  • Satisfaction of all general education requirements. Typically, an earned Associate of Arts or Associate of Science from a regionally accredited institution will satisfy the requirement.
  • Satisfaction of all proficiency requirements.
  • Submission of Intent to Graduate with the Office of the Registrar six months before anticipated degree completion
  • Payment of all tuition and fees
  • Approval by the faculty and Board of Trustees

The request to transfer-in coursework must be made in writing prior to beginning the bachelor’s program. Course equivalencies considered for transfer are determined by the Registrar’s Office in consultation with the appropriate faculty and/or chair.
